Tomoka is a name often given to girls. Ranked #16375 and holds a steady place on the charts. It comes from a Japanese (East Asian) origin and traditionally means "Wise child with a gentle and thoughtful heart". It has 3 syllables.
Rooted in Japanese sounds implying wisdom and friendship. Tomoka remains uncommon outside Japan yet appeals globally for its elegant simplicity. It suggests a balanced personality blending intellect with empathy. Modern parents value its cultural resonance and peaceful vibe.
